Bio

After 40 years working in paper mills in a wide variety of roles, I am now consulting with specialty paper companies and their partners on new sustainable paper packaging. My primary objective is increase recycling and composting of paper products, in an effort to reduce global climate change. When I am not providing technical advice, I cycle, sail, raise a garden, cook, and travel. Looking forward to providing key insights to help the next generation of papermakers on their career path.
